GFWC Juniors’ Special Program: Advocates for Children is designed to encourage all Women’s, Junior, Juniorette, and International Affiliate clubs to make a difference in our world by becoming advocates for children. Members may choose to organize projects that benefit children in their community, state, or the world. Clubwomen can become advocates by working to ensure that children are protected from harmful situations, encourage healthy physical and emotional lifestyles, impact policy to improve children’s lives.

GFWC Florida clubwomen design and support programs that allow them to serve as advocates for children in their local communities.
